section { content-visibility: unset !important; }

.video-button-shortcode { padding-left: 45px !important; position: relative; }

.video-button-shortcode svg { width: 25px; height: auto; position: absolute; top: 50%; -webkit-transform: translateY(-50%); transform: translateY(-50%); left: 10px; }

.video-modal-shortcode { background-color: rgba(21, 20, 23, 0.6); }

.video-modal-shortcode .modal-header .close, .video-modal-shortcode .modal-header { padding: 0; }

.video-modal-shortcode .modal-header { margin-top: -13px; margin-bottom: 13px; }

.video-modal-shortcode .modal-dialog { max-width: 640px; height: auto; margin: auto; }

.video-modal-shortcode .modal-dialog .modal-content { padding: 16px; padding-top: 29px; border-radius: 8px; height: auto; }

.video-modal-shortcode .video-container { position: relative; padding-bottom: 56.25%; padding-top: 30px; height: 0; overflow: hidden; }

.video-modal-shortcode .video-container iframe, .video-modal-shortcode .video-container object, .video-modal-shortcode .video-container embed { position: absolute; top: 0; left: 0; width: 100%; height: 100%; }

/*# sourceMappingURL=video_button.css.map */
